To be fair they don't need to be in debt or have a mortgage to rent out a room. Ir could be for supplementary income or to offset cost of maintaining a home/paying property taxes.

Typically most private rentals require 1 year leases with 2 months rent upfront (1st and last months rent) and come unfurnished. Housing costs are high in the GTA so most landlord are trying to cover some costs and in order to give up your privacy it has to be worth your while. Without any idea how much you want to spend and what you think is inexpensive/expensive it is hard for people to provide guidance.

I am about to move to Canada for first time. How to find homestays for 2-3 months till i receive my PR card?
Check Airbnb or VRBO (vacation rentals by owner) which are targeted towards travellers. They don't need job/credit history (which you will need for a rental later). Good luck.
